Step 1: Emergency Response and Assessment

Upon arrival, our technicians will quickly assess the situation, identifying the source and extent of the water damage. We'll work with you to create a customized plan to address your specific needs. Accurate assessment is key to effective restoration.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Removal

Using our powerful truck-mounted extractors, we'll carefully remove standing water and begin the drying process.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and promoting a healthy environment. Our equipment is built for efficiency and effectiveness.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ians will deploy specialized drying equipment to speed up the evaporation process, reducing the risk of mold and bacterial growth. We'll also use dehumidifying units to lower the humidity levels in your home. Proper drying prevents long-term damage and health risks.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

With the drying process complete, our team will sanitize and disinfect your space using EPA-registered cleaning products. This step ensures that your home is not only dry but also safe and free from bacteria and mold. A healthy environment is just a call away.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ration

Warning Signs You Need Dishwasher Leak Water Removal

Ignoring these sign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don't wait, address these issues quickly to protect your home and family. Early detection saves you money and stress.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show hidden water damage. If you notice a musty smell in your kitchen or surrounding areas, it's time to call a professional. Don't ignore the warning signs.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ration on your wal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of a more extensive water damage issue. Act quickly to prevent further damage. Don't wait for the problem to worsen.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a result of water damage. This is not only unsightly but also poses a tripping hazard. Call a professional to assess and repair the damage. Don't compromise on safety.

Visible Leaks or Water Spots

Leaks or water spots on your dishwasher, sink, or surrounding areas can show a serious issue. Don't delay, fix the leak quickly to prevent further damage. Swift action prevents costly repairs.

Water Damage in Unseen Areas

Water damage can occur in unseen areas, like behind walls or under flooring. If you suspect hidden damage, call a professional for a thorough assessment. Don't underestimate the power of water damage.

Dishwasher Leak Water Removal Cost in Kiln, MS

The cost of Dishwasher Leak Water Removal services var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Kiln, MS. These are estimates, not guarantees. Get a free assessment for an accurate qu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and drying time
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$100 - $500 Type of equipment used, size of affected area, and level of sanitizing required
Final Inspection and Restoration $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and level of expertise required
Hidden Water Damage Detection and Repair $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and level of expertise required
Structural Damage Repair $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and level of expertise required

Q: Is Dishwasher Leak Water Removal a health risk?

A: Yes, water damage from a dishwasher leak can pose health risks, especially if left untreated. Hidden moisture can lead to mold growth, which can cause serious health issues. Q: Can I prevent future Dishwasher Leak Water Removal by performing regular maintenance?

A: Yes, regular maintenance can help prevent future leaks and water damage. Our team recommends checking your dishwasher's hoses, connections, and seals regularly and addressing any issues quickly. Prevention is key to avoiding costly repairs.
